Output e75421815b341c647c76c49489c8e1b20dd2f1733ea99c39e8bdbf66cc1637b0:3

value
2664936
script pubkey
OP_0 OP_PUSHBYTES_20 db7e2ef4829431f49499b2f63f60f1b48142e323
address
bc1qmdlzaayzjsclf9yektmr7c83kjq59cergmggh3
transaction
e75421815b341c647c76c49489c8e1b20dd2f1733ea99c39e8bdbf66cc1637b0
confirmations
174824
spent
true